1. Identify Your Genre and Style

Before you start browsing, get clear on your genre. Are you making trap, R&B, pop, hip-hop, or something experimental? Each genre has its own sonic signature—tempo, instrumentation, and rhythm patterns. Knowing your lane helps you narrow down thousands of beats to a manageable selection. 2. Match the Beat to Your Mood and Message

What emotion do you want to convey? A melancholic piano loop might suit a heartfelt ballad, while a hard-hitting 808 trap beat could amplify an aggressive rap track. Listen to the beat and ask yourself: does this enhance the story I'm telling? The best beats don't just sound good—they amplify your lyrics and vocal delivery. 3. Consider Tempo and Key

Tempo (BPM) affects the energy of your song. Slow tempos (60-90 BPM) work well for ballads and chill vibes, while faster tempos (120-160 BPM) are great for upbeat, energetic tracks. The key of the beat should also match your vocal range. If you're not sure, consult a vocal coach or use tools to find your comfortable key. 4. Listen for Quality and Mixing

A professionally mixed beat sounds clean, balanced, and radio-ready. Avoid beats with clipping, muddy frequencies, or poor separation. 5. Check Licensing and Usage Rights

One of the biggest mistakes artists make is not understanding the licensing terms. Will you own the beat exclusively? Can you monetize your song on streaming platforms?
